分片(partitioning)就是将你的数据拆分到多个 Redis 实例的过程,这样每个实例将只包含所有键的子集。
分片能做什么 Redis 的分片承担着两个主要目标:允许使用很多电脑的内存总和来支持更大的数据库。没有分片,你就被局限于单机能支持的内存容量。允许伸缩计算能力到多核或多服务器,伸缩网络带宽到多服务器或多网络适配器。
分片方式(多种) 有很多不同的分片标准(c
# 使用 MySQL 的 NOT IN 子句:新手开发者的完整指南
在数据库管理中,查询数据是基本且重要的一环。MySQL 提供了多种方式来筛选和限制数据,其中 "NOT IN" 子句是非常常用的。对于刚入行的开发者来说,了解如何有效使用 "NOT IN" 的语法非常重要。本篇文章将带你了解如何实现 “MySQL NOT IN” 的最佳实践。
## 1. 整体流程
我们将从总体上展示使用 "
原创
2024-08-04 06:01:18
48阅读
# MongoDB查看分片数量的方法
## 简介
在MongoDB中,分片是将数据水平拆分为多个部分,以便能够处理更大规模的数据集。了解如何查看MongoDB中有多少个分片对于管理员和开发人员来说非常重要。在本文中,我将向您展示如何使用MongoDB的命令行界面和JavaScript代码来查看MongoDB中的分片数量。
## 流程概述
下表展示了查看MongoDB中分片数量的步骤和相应的代码
原创
2023-11-13 06:19:10
160阅读
Elasticsearch 提供无缝扩展体验的能力的核心在于其跨机器分配工作负载的能力。这是通过Elasticsearch的sharding. 创建索引时,您为该Elasticsearch 索引设置主分片和副本分片计数。Elasticsearch 将您的数据和请求分布在这些分片之间,以及跨数据节点的分片上。Elasticsearch 集群的容量和性能主要取决
# 如何搭建 Redis Cluster
## 概述
在搭建 Redis Cluster 之前,首先要了解 Redis Cluster 的概念。Redis Cluster 是 Redis 的分布式解决方案,可以将多个 Redis 节点组成集群,实现数据的分片存储和高可用性。在 Redis Cluster 中,会有多个 master 节点和多个 slave 节点,每个 master 节点可以有多个
原创
2024-05-04 05:06:45
26阅读
n 什么是插槽 插槽是Redis对Key进行分片的单元。在Redis的集群实现中,内置了数据自动分片机 制,集群内部会将所有的key映射到16384个插槽中,集群中的每个数据库实例负责其中部 分的插槽的读写。n 键与插槽的关系 Redis会将key的有效部分,使用CRC16算法计算出散列值,然后对16384取余数,从 而把key分配到插槽中。键名的有效部分规则是: 1:如果键名包含{},那么有效部
转载
2024-01-10 11:14:24
43阅读
大多数Elasticsearch用户在创建索引时的一个关键问题是“我应该使用多少个分片?”在本文中,我将介绍在分片分配时的一些权衡以及不同设置带来的性能影响.。如果你想学习如何神秘化和优化你的分片策略请继续阅读。为什么优化?这是一个重要的话题, 很多用户对如何分片都有所疑惑, 有个最好的理由就是. 在生产环境中, 随着数据集的不断增长, 不合理的分配策略可能会给系统的扩展带来严重的问题.同时, 这
转载
2024-07-29 20:05:12
121阅读
Redis 本身并没有直接提供一个命令来查看一个特定的 key 占用了多少内存。但是,你可以通过一些间接的方法来估算这个值。以下是一些建议的方法:使用 DEBUG OBJECT 命令:虽然这不是一个官方推荐或稳定的命令,但在某些 Redis 版本中,你可以使用 DEBUG OBJECT <key> 命令来获取关于 key 的详细信息,包括其序列化后的长度(serializedlengt
转载
2024-06-19 08:37:16
35阅读
# 教学文章:如何获取Redis中括号的数量
## 1. 介绍
你好,作为一名经验丰富的开发者,我将教你如何在Redis中获取括号的数量。这是一个简单但有意义的任务,让我们一起来完成吧!
## 2. 流程步骤
首先,让我们来看看整个过程的步骤:
| 步骤 | 操作 |
|------|------|
| 1 | 连接到Redis数据库 |
| 2 | 获取存储在Redis中的值
原创
2024-04-17 03:46:15
32阅读
如何统计 Redis 中的 key 数量
## 1. 简介
在 Redis 中,key 是用于存储数据的唯一标识符。有时候我们需要知道 Redis 中有多少个 key,以便于监控和优化 Redis 的性能。本文将介绍如何通过 Redis 命令行和编程语言来统计 Redis 中的 key 数量。
## 2. 统计流程
下面是统计 Redis 中 key 数量的流程图:
```mermaid
e
原创
2024-01-20 09:48:17
73阅读
# 如何实现“redis 库名 多少个”
## 引言
作为一名经验丰富的开发者,我将会以清晰明了的步骤和示例代码来教你如何在Redis中查询某个数据库下有多少个键值对。
### 流程概述
1. 连接Redis数据库
2. 获取指定数据库下的所有键
3. 统计键的数量
### 步骤表格
| 步骤 | 操作 |
|------|------|
| 1 | 连接Redis数据库 |
| 2
原创
2024-03-04 07:00:20
27阅读
# 如何查看Redis库中有多少个键
Redis是一个开源的内存数据结构存储系统,广泛应用于缓存和消息代理等场景。当你想查看Redis库中有多少个键时,可以按照以下步骤进行操作。本文将为你详细讲解每一步的实现流程,并提供相关的代码示例。
## 实施流程
以下是查看Redis中的键数量的步骤:
| 步骤 | 描述 |
|------|------|
| 1 | 确保已安装Redis,并
原创
2024-08-23 03:32:45
16阅读
# Redis查看多少个database
Redis是一种基于内存的高性能键值存储系统,不仅提供了丰富的数据类型和操作命令,还支持多个database的划分。本文将介绍如何查看Redis中有多少个database,并提供相应的代码示例。
## Redis数据库
Redis中的数据库可以看作是一个键值对的集合,每个键值对都保存在一个database中。默认情况下,Redis有16个databa
原创
2024-01-25 14:26:06
173阅读
# 如何获取Redis中有多少个Database
## 简介
在Redis中,一个实例可以包含多个Database,每个Database都是独立的,可以存储不同的数据。对于开发者来说,了解Redis中有多少个Database是很有必要的,因为这涉及到数据的组织和管理。本文将介绍如何通过代码获取Redis中有多少个Database。
## 流程图
```mermaid
graph LR
A[连
原创
2023-10-19 14:46:10
89阅读
# 如何实现Redis支持多个DB
## 关系图
```mermaid
erDiagram
USER ||--o DATABASE : 一个用户拥有多个数据库
```
## 整体流程
1. 创建一个Redis连接
2. 选择要操作的DB
3. 进行操作
## 具体步骤
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 创建一个Redis连接 |
| 2 | 选
原创
2024-05-01 07:05:31
15阅读
# Redis支持多少个key的实现方法
## 简介
Redis是一个开源的内存数据存储,可以用作数据库、缓存和消息中间件。它支持多种数据结构,如字符串、哈希表、列表、集合和有序集合,并提供了丰富的命令来操作这些数据结构。在Redis中,可以存储大量的key-value数据对。本文将介绍如何利用Redis的命令来统计Redis支持的key的数量。
## 实现步骤
下面是实现Redis支持多
原创
2023-11-02 12:38:23
63阅读
Redis 是一个高性能的键值存储系统,常用于缓存、消息队列、计数器等应用场景。在 Redis 中,可以存储大量的 key-value 对,但是具体可以存储多少个 key 取决于配置和硬件资源。
## Redis 的存储结构
Redis 的数据存储结构是一个高性能的哈希表,它可以存储不同类型的数据,包括字符串、列表、哈希、集合和有序集合。每个 key 都是一个唯一的字符串,而 value 可以
原创
2023-08-23 04:13:36
213阅读
一、String
概述:String是redis最基本的类型,最大能存储512MB的数据,
String类型是二进制安全的,即可以存储任何数据、比如数字、照片、序列化对象等。
1、设置
a、设置键值
set key value
b、设置键值及过期时间,以秒为单位
setex key seconds valu
转载
2024-02-03 17:42:25
59阅读
一、windows 安装 redis答:官方网站未提供,但微软为window提供了可测试的redis,下面是教程 在 windows 上安装 Redis ,下载压缩包zip格式文件。学习redis的资料: Windows 10 安装 Redis_veryitman的博客windows10安装redis二、Linux 安装 redis1. 安装redis的包(Linux环境下)#在opt目录下解压
转载
2023-08-24 15:26:26
99阅读
我应该设置多少个分片?我应该设置多大的分片?Elasticsearch 是一个功能十分丰富的平台,支持各种用例,能够在数
原创
2022-11-14 16:23:04
214阅读